VIDEO: Alabama LB Ben Davis prepared to have his moment this year

After four years of toiling, becoming familiar with the defense and finding his niche as a player, Ben Davis is finally ready to have his moment at Alabama.

He enters his redshirt senior season in the fall and as a former five-star, the door of opportunity is open at outside linebacker.

He’s had some rough moments; however, sources confirmed with yours truly of Touchdown Alabama Magazine on Monday on the product from Gordo (Ala.) High School telling those closest to him that he will start this year.

The 6-foot-3, 243-pounder saw action in 11 games last season and recorded four tackles with one for loss – including a sack versus Mississippi State. 

Despite Crimson Tide fans being excited about other players at linebacker, Davis returns as the oldest at the position.

Some people have written him off, while others still have faith in the son of former Tide legend Wayne Davis. In this segment of In My Own Words, I broke down the trials of Davis and how he is prepared to officially have an impact on defense for this team.
